This park is really high in biodiversity, including both plant and animal biodiveristy. I love it for birdwatching, and I have also used it as a seed source for ecological restoration projects, and inspiration for my plant website, bplant.org. There is an extensive wetland as well as several sections of mature floodplain forest. The park also spans two different soil types, and it is fascinating to see the differences in flora in the different areas of the park.

A great first park. Two small play structures are just routine, but it also has a section with some sculptures to climb on (porpoise, turtle, and some more abstract ones), a boardwalk over the wetland that is astonshingly beautiful at some times of year, and another bridge over a creek that frequently has frogs to view. Closer to the parking lot theres a small path thru the woods with some short bridges, plus tennis courts, basketball courts, skate parks, and a port-o-potty.
